**Mgmt Meeting Minutes — Retiring the Brightline Range**

Quick recap for sales leads at Fenholt Supplies: we agreed to retire the Brightline fixture range by year-end. Remaining stock moves to clearance pricing next month, and accounts on standing orders get migrated to the Lumetta range. Trade-in incentives were approved in principle. The confidential note on next steps sits just below.

board note of bajof-bajeg: The pricing group signed off on a budget of $13.4 million for Project Sildor. The renewal with Lamixek Holdings closes at $48.9 million a year, 49 percent above the last contract.

MEMO — Hallowmere Testing Centre

Hi team, quick heads-up: the sealed exam papers for the Brackenfold Certification round arrive Thursday morning via Quillart Couriers. Don't break the tamper seals — that's the invigilation office's job only. Store the crate in the locked annexe until Marta from Assessments signs it in. One more thing before the courier shows up: the hand-over instruction below must be followed exactly as written.

dispatch memo: the eliath belael courier leaves the praox ledger at gate 8841 under passcode 017589

Quarterly Planning Note — Branch Managers

The licensing dispute with Pellwright Media over the Aurivale content library remains unresolved. Legal expects arbitration to conclude next quarter; until then, branches must not distribute Aurivale materials or reference them in client proposals. Budget provisions for a possible settlement have been made centrally, so no branch-level reserves are required. The dispute affects our planning for the coming year, as described confidentially below.

internal memo for kahop-yajof: The steering committee signed off on a budget of $12.6 million for Project Jorwyn. The renewal with Quenoxox Logistics closes at $16.8 million a year, 48 percent above the last contract.